Avenged Sevenfold - Live in the LBC / Diamonds in the Rough!

Warner Records

• A7X bring their unholy confessions to the screen.

The first half of this two-disc DVD/CD combo, Live in theLBC, capturesAvenged Sevenfold’s headlining concert at the Long Beach Arena in sunnySouthern California, marking the first time the band has produced a live DVD.Shot in high definition with 5.1 audio, the disc delivers an impressive view ofthe rising metal gods laying waste to an adoring hometown crowd. Theaccompanying CD release, Diamonds in the Rough!, is a B-sides and rarities rehash.Representing the amalgamation of previously unreleased material, such as thenightmarish opener “Demon” and the hellacious “Tension,” the majority of these Diamonds were lifted from the group’s 2007recording sessions. The unlikely high point comes in the form of faithfullyrendered covers of Iron Maiden’s “Flash of the Blade” and Pantera’s “Walk.” Inaddition, Avenged Sevenfold has gone back and re-TOOLed (so to speak) severalof their most successful songs, including “never-heard-before” versions of“Almost Easy” and “Afterlife.” Not just a double-barrelled blast of metalcoreclout for the established A7X fan, the combination of Live in the LBC and Diamonds in the Rough! are an excellent point of entry fornew listeners who are still at that awkward “getting to know you” stage.
